I recently visited Lavandula Farm, a historic Swiss-Italian-inspired lavender farm just outside Daylesford, and I was honestly blown away by it. Originally settled in the 1850s by Swiss-Italian immigrants, it began as a working dairy farm and has since been beautifully restored into one of Australia’s most unique rural wedding destinations.
Walking through the property, you really feel the blend of rustic stone buildings, European-style gardens, and sweeping lavender fields. It has this calm, romantic energy to it, like a little pocket of Europe tucked into the Victorian countryside, and it’s easy to see why so many couples fall in love with it for their wedding day.

One of the most beautiful aspects of a Lavandula Farm is the variety of ceremony locations available throughout the property. Couples can exchange vows surrounded by lavender fields, beneath the romantic rose arch, or along the symmetrical trees. There are also stunning open spaces beneath large established trees, creating a peaceful and intimate atmosphere for outdoor ceremonies.
Each ceremony location offers a completely different visual feel, allowing couples to personalise their wedding day while still embracing the romantic European-inspired charm that Lavandula Farm is known for. For me, Lavandula Farm is one of the most visually diverse wedding venues in Victoria. The lavender fields create a soft romantic atmosphere, especially in full bloom. The towering trees provide beautiful texture and seasonal colour throughout autumn while also creating stunning shaded areas during summer weddings.
The olive groves bring a timeless European-inspired feel to wedding portraits, while the symmetrical tree-lined lanes create incredible leading lines and focal points within photographs. The property also features a luxurious dam, a charming hanging bridge, and a small flowing river that all add variety and depth to wedding galleries.
One of the biggest advantages of photographing weddings here is that couples can achieve multiple completely different visual backdrops without needing to travel between locations. This allows for a far more relaxed wedding timeline while still creating a diverse and storytelling-focused gallery.
